What is Control Stations Form

The Customer Requirements Control Stations Form is a Request for Quote (RFQ) used by businesses to gather detailed technical and logistical specifications for control stations from customers.

Key Features of the Customer Requirements Control Stations Form

  • Customer no.: Identifies the customer uniquely to streamline tracking.
  • Max. voltage: Essential for assessing system compatibility and safety.
  • Max. current: Helps in determining the system's electrical requirements.
  • Description: Offers flexibility for users to provide further details.
These features not only aid in precise data collection but also promote effective communication between customers and businesses. The structure of the form allows for seamless interaction, minimizing misunderstandings and errors.
